ROCKWELL BROWN Red Blend, Red Mountain 2007

This now defunct winery has some pretty exceptional juice. This is a blend of 70% Cabernet with 24% Merlot and the rest Petite Verdot and Cabernet Franc. The wine opens with delicious aromas of cassis, dill and blackberry. The expressive palate has flavors remiscent of black olive, blackberry and mocha. This is a wonderful effort and strikes a nice balance between fruit and structure. (Best 2015-2025) - November, 2015 (OB)


92 POINTS
